button-match

Arguments: button-state button-form

Compares the button-state to the buttons described in button-form. button-form is recursively defined as follows:

simple-button-form | 
(only simple-button-form) |
(not button-form) |
(or button-form*) | 
(and button-form*) | 
NONE | 
nil | 
UP

Where simple-button-form can be any constant with an integer value. Examples of button-forms are:

meta-key 
(only shift-key)
(and (or shift-key meta-key) (not left-mouse-button))
